House Foundation Leveling in Columbus, OH
House foundation leveling services involve adjusting and stabilizing a building’s foundation to ensure it remains even and secure. This process is commonly requested for homes experiencing uneven floors, cracks in walls, or doors and windows that no longer open properly. Projects typically include lifting and supporting the foundation, repairing or replacing damaged sections, and restoring proper alignment to prevent further structural issues. Homeowners often seek this service after noticing signs of settling or shifting, aiming to protect their property’s stability and value.
Before requesting foundation leveling,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the work involved, including the methods used and the potential impact on their home. It’s helpful to consider the extent of any existing damage, the age of the foundation, and whether additional repairs might be necessary. Clarifying these details can assist in making informed decisions about the project, ensuring the foundation’s stability is restored effectively and safely.

Common House Foundation Leveling Jobs
Foundation Repair - stabilizes and restores the integrity of settling or cracked foundations.
House Leveling - corrects uneven floors and structural shifts caused by soil movement.
Pier and Beam Leveling - adjusts and supports homes built on pier and beam foundations.
Concrete Slab Leveling - raises sunken or uneven concrete slabs to improve safety and appearance.
Foundation Underpinning - strengthens and reinforces weakened foundation areas.
Structural Assessment - evaluates foundation conditions to determine necessary leveling or repairs.
House Foundation Leveling Questions
What causes a house to need foundation leveling? Shifts in soil, moisture changes, and settling over time can lead to uneven foundations requiring leveling.
How can foundation leveling improve a property? It helps stabilize the structure, prevents further damage, and maintains the home’s value and safety.
What signs indicate a foundation may need leveling? Visible cracks,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around the foundation are common indicators.
Is foundation leveling suitable for all types of properties? It is often appropriate for residential and commercial properties experiencing uneven settling or shifting.
